Surveys

Managing a post-secondary program requires continuous improvement. In order to do this
I have the students evaluate the program at various points throughout the program. One of the challenges is that there are limited numbers of respondents and to be effective they need to be anonymous. This week I came across http://www.survs.com/ it allows you to create and distribute surveys and then collates the data for you. The software seems relatively easy to use and is free with 200 or less responders. I am trying it out and hopeful that it will be useful!

RSS

This week we learned about RSS (Really Simple Syndication). A method of flagging or following sites/blogs. It alerts you when one that you are following has been updated. You customize your own list so you can follow the things that interest you the most.

This is an interesting and useful tool to help sort through all the information available. It could be useful in the work or educational environment if you find a blog that explores topics pertinent to the topic being taught. It can also be used in the educational environment as we are in this class by having each student create a blog and all other students in the class follow each others blogs.
